Disappointing result, but overall, I'm relatively happy with our performance today. We dominated for the majority of the game, but seriously lacked a cutting edge and didn't create or threaten the goal anywhere near enough. Milan were very good on the counter, and definitely deserved their victory.
Robbie experimenting with Meireles in such an advanced position proved to be a failure, and it's no coincidence that the second he came off and Hazard was moved in there in his place, we looked much better. Lukaku again disappointed, and there should be no doubt left that he's not yet ready to challenge for a place in the team. Hazard and Marin did well again I thought, with the latter once again making quite a case for himself as far as starting places go.
Another thing that I feel will need to be looked at is the midfield pivot. We all know Lamps and Mikel have been first choice since Robbie started employing them there when he first took over in March. They performed very well there last season, but only because we based our philosophy at that time primarily on defense and counterattacking. If we're serious about becoming a more attractive, attacking side, though, the two of them aren't going to cut it. There's no pace, no creativity, no urgency, etc. Considering there are no obvious better options there at this point (with Oscar hopefully growing into the role in time), this is yet another situation that highlights once again that we're in a transitional period and that it will take time.
Overall though, tonight was a typical case of decent performance, bad result, in my opinion. Still much to improve on, while also alot to be happy with and optimistic about
